Choosing Your Perfect Seating

When assembling your dining area, the table often takes center stage. But don't underestimate the impact of dining chairs! They enhance the look and offer a comfortable experience for meals.

Selecting chairs that contrast with your table's style is key. A rustic oak table might complement nicely with cozy, upholstered chairs in a rich hue.

Conversely, a sleek, modern metallic table could benefit from minimalist dining chairs with clean lines and neutral tones.

Remember, your dining chairs should not only complement visually but also be ergonomic for long meals and discussions.

Contemporary Dining Table Design Trends

The dining table continues as a focal point in the home, a space for gatherings. Today's trends in dining table design reflect a desire for both usefulness and visual appeal. From sleek, minimalist silhouettes to bold, statement pieces, modern dining tables offer many choices to suit every style.

  • Natural materials like wood and stone are increasingly popular, adding a touch of warmth and genuineness to the space.
  • Glass top tables bring an air of sophistication, while metal accents provide a industrial edge.
  • Unique shapes, such as round or oval designs, are rising in popularity, creating a more cozy atmosphere.
Whether you prefer a classic or avant-garde look, there's a modern dining table out there to make a statement in your home.
